Multi-Channel Delivery / Customer Data IntegrationMulti-Channel Delivery / Customer Data Integration

Over the last several years banks have introduced a variety of new delivery channels to their retail and commercial customers, and it is essential for banks to address two important goals:
  • Multi-Channel Delivery (MCD): Provide an integrated and consistent banking experience to retail and commercial customers across all delivery channels.
  • Customer Data Integration (CDI): Obtain complete, cross-channel and cross-product customer view, and deliver it to customer touch points in real time, enabling effective, just-in-time marketing strategies.
However, achieving these seemingly trivial goals in real life is a major challenge for most banks, due to the high complexity of integration associated with the traditional "point-to-point integration link" approach:

Avantek targets the Multi-Channel Delivery and Customer Data Integration challenges through its Banking Services Integration solution, Avanta Banking Services Hub, which provides banks with complete, actionable, cross-channel view of customers, interactions, accounts, transactions, and products, by converging isolated back-office systems into a single, consistent data and services hub.
